Sitebrand year-end results mixed
GATINEAU – Sitebrand Inc. wraps up its first year as a public company with a 12.7% increase in revenues, although net losses almost double. The maker of solutions for personalizing websites reports fiscal 2008 revenues of $2.16 million, compared to $1.92 million for 2007. Net loss was $2.3 million, more than double the $1.0 million in losses the company reported a year ago. “In an environment of economic uncertainty, we are pleased with our sales results and trend of year-over-year revenue growth.” says Justin Shimoon, CEO and founder. “Sitebrand continues to be a leader in the online message and conversion optimization market.” Click here for more information.
